
Heading into the 2025 MLB playoffs, Vladimir Guerrero Jr. and the Toronto Blue Jays had a reputation for not performing in the postseason. Vladdy Jr. and company have shattered that narrative by beating the New York Yankees and Seattle Mariners en route to their first World Series berth since 1993, where they face the defending-champion Los Angeles Dodgers.
Guerrero Jr. signed a 14-year, $500 million contract with the Blue Jays in April, and just one season into his mammoth deal he is four wins away from delivering Toronto their first championship in more than 30 years. He’s been a menace to pitchers in the playoffs especially, batting .442 with six home runs and 12 RBIs in 11 games.
Three of his home runs came against the Seattle Mariners in the American League Championship Series to go with 10 hits and four walks to just two strikeouts to earn ALCS MVP honors.
